However, popular Telugu actor Chalapathi Rao took media and Freedom of Speech for granted and spoke something that should have never been said. During a popular reality TV show, the character artist said that “Women are not injurious to mental peace, they’re fit for sleeping with men.”

However, one thing stays unambiguous – why did the anchor ask the question “Are women injurious to mental peace?” Is that even the right kind of question to ask. Oh, and the anchor was a woman herself. It’s high time such questions are encouraged in the name of Humour and TRP for a channel. The male anchor encouraging the actor’s comment immediately called it a “super comment”. Tollywood’s stars Rakul Preet Singh and Naga Chaitanya were also present promoting their film ‘Ra Randoi Veduka Chuddam’. While Rakul couldn’t believe what she heard, Naga Chaitanya was laughing.

While it isn’t clear whether their reactions were to this comment, or were edited into the video later, neither of them decided to speak out at the event. Actor Chalapathi Rao, looking at all the tweets and posts, finally responded back with a video. In that, he said:

Reacting to the controversy around his comment, the actor wondered “why the media feels what I said is so wrong.”

“Can you even ask that question? What does ‘women being injurious to mental peace’ even mean? Do we sleep with snakes? No. That’s why I said women are harmless and that’s why we sleep with them. I don’t even know why the media feels what I said is so wrong. Some channel, which does not know Telugu, published it and everyone else spread it again and again like cancer. I have never put women down. We look at women like mothers and sisters with respect always. Jai Mahila Lokam,” the actor said in a video.
